Ingredients
-
3/4 cbutter
-
1-1/2 cfirmly packed light brown sugar
-
1egg
-
1-1/2 cflour
-
1/2 tspbaking powder
-
1/4 tspsalt
-
1 ccoarsely chopped pecans or walnuts
-
1 cbutterscotch chips or mini chocolate chips
How to Make New York Blondies
- In a saucepan, over very gentle heat, melt the butter and brown sugar together and cook until the sugar dissolves, between 5-8 minutes. Let cool.
- In a mixing bowl, stir together cooled sugar/butter mixture and add egg, blending well.
Stir in flour, baking powder, salt, nuts, butterscotch or chocolate chips.
Spread batter evenly, using a wet knife or spatula, into a greased and floured 9 X 13 inch pan. - Bake at 350 degrees for 22 to 27 minutes. Do not over bake. Squares will seem set, but might be slightly jiggly.
Cool in refrigerator after they have cooled on the counter for about half an hour.
Cut in pan.
